深入解析比特币多重签名钱包及其安全优势
比特币多重签名钱包是一种增强安全性的数字钱包,允许多个用户共同管理和控制同一比特币地址的访问权限。相比传统的单签名钱包,多重签名钱包在提高安全性的同时,也给用户带来了更多的灵活性和便捷性。这篇文章将深入探讨比特币多重签名钱包的工作原理、安全优势、实施方式以及常见问题。我们将通过具体的案例和技术细节,帮助用户深入理解这项技术。
比特币多重签名钱包的基本概念
多重签名(Multisig)是一种安全措施,意味着为了执行某个操作(比如交易),需要多个私钥的签名。在比特币的生态系统中,一般有如下几种多重签名结构:
- 2-of-3:意味着三个密钥中至少需要两个密钥签名才能完成交易。
- 3-of-5:意味着五个密钥中至少需要三个密钥签名才能完成交易。
这样的结构可以极大减少单点故障的风险。例如,假设五个合作者共同管理一个钱包,这样即使其中一两位合作者的私钥被盗,他们也无法单独撤回资金。同时,多重签名钱包实际上也可以用于权限控制,例如企业可以要求多个管理层签署才能进行资金转移,以此来防止内部的舞弊行为。
多重签名钱包的工作原理
比特币多重签名钱包的工作原理非常简单。用户首先需要在所用的比特币钱包中生成多个私钥。这些私钥可以由不同的人或设备持有。接下来,在构建多重签名地址时,用户需要设定一个条件,例如“2-of-3”,此时需要三个密钥地址,其中任意两个密钥必须签署才能进行交易。
每当用户想要进行比特币转账时,交易信息会被广播到网络中。钱包会首先要求相应的任意两个密钥进行签名,每个签名都会附加到交易中,然后最终由网络确认。这种方法增加了对比特币的控制力,同时降低了因单个私钥泄露而造成的风险。
多重签名钱包的安全优势
多重签名钱包在安全性方面的优势体现在多个方面:
- 防止单点失败:如果一个私钥丢失或被盗,攻击者无法单独控制跟多重签名钱包关联的资产。这种分散化管理方式为资金安全增加了一层额外的保障。
- 社交合约:多重签名钱包适用于社交合约场合,例如共同投资。如果所有合作方都需签字才能进行交易,这样可以有效避免争议和误操作。
- 灵活的控制权限:可以根据需要设定不同的签名要求,例如多重签名钱包可以在某些情况下需要更多的人参与决策,从而可以更好地管理大型投资。
如何设置多重签名钱包
用户在设置多重签名钱包时,需遵循一系列步骤。以使用一个流行的比特币钱包(如Electrum)为例:
- 下载并安装钱包软件:选择一个支持多重签名的钱包,并下载到设备上。
- 创建一个新的钱包:在创建钱包时选择多重签名钱包选项,并决定签名规则(例如2-of-3)。
- 生成多个私钥:根据设定的规则生成多个密钥,并将这些密钥分配给不同的人或安全的位置。
- 进行备份:确保永久备份所有密钥信息,因为丢失任何一个密钥可能导致无法访问其相关资金。
- 测试交易:进行少量资金的测试转账,以确保多重签名的设置正常工作。
常见关于多重签名钱包的问题
在使用多重签名钱包的过程中,用户经常会遇到一些问题。以下是5个常见的
1. 多重签名钱包的一般工作流程是什么?
多重签名钱包的一般工作流程如下:
- 创建钱包:用户在选择的钱包程序中设置一个多重签名钱包,设定需要多少个签名才能批准交易。
- 生成密钥对:用户会生成多组密钥(例如3组密钥),并分配给多个用户。
- 发起交易:当一种比特币转账需要被批准时,发起者会创建一个交易并要求至少设定数量的密钥进行签名。
- 验证签名:确保所有签名有效,符合设定的签名数量要求。
- 广播交易:交易得到批准后,广播到比特币网络。
- 网络确认:交易得到比特币矿工的确认后,交易成功完成。
这种工作流程确保了资金的高安全性和灵活性。因为无论是管理多个账户还是参与多方合作,这种签名系统都能大大降低欺诈风险。
2. 我应该如何保管我的多重签名私钥?
保存多重签名私钥的最佳实践包括:
- 实体备份:将私钥以书面或纸质备份的方式保留下来,不存于电子设备中以降低被黑客攻击的风险。
- 密钥分散:将多个私钥保存在不同的地点,可以是家中和银行的安全箱等地方。即使一个位置被盗,攻击者也无法访问所有私钥。
- 加密存储:总是将私钥存储在加密的设备中,并使用强密码进行保护。
通过以上方法,使用者可以确保在意外情况发生时,仍能安全地访问其比特币资产。
3. 多重签名钱包最适合哪些用户群体?
多重签名钱包适合于:
- 企业组织:企业可能需要多人共同批准交易,以防止舞弊和诈骗。多重签名钱包可以帮助实现这一目标。
- 投资团队:在共同投资的情况下,各方同意设定多重签名规则,以确保资金共同管理。
- 个人用户:对于希望额外保护其资产的个人用户,多重签名钱包也非常有利。
需要注意的是,用户在设置多重签名钱包时,应确保所有相关人员都了解如何使用这项技术,以维护操作的流畅性和安全性。
4. 多重签名钱包的缺点是什么?
虽然多重签名钱包有许多优势,但也存在一些潜在的缺点:
- 操作复杂性:相比普通钱包,多重签名钱包的设置和操作更加复杂,可能需要用户进行额外的学习。
- 签名协调:当多方参与时,协调完成每个签名可能变得具有挑战性,尤其当某些参与者在远程或时区不同的情况下。
- 难以恢复:如果某一方的密钥丢失且无法恢复,可能会影响所有者对资产的访问。这就要求对于密钥进行更好的管理和备份。
综合考虑,用户须明白多重签名钱包既有其安全性,也有操作的复杂性。因此,选择是否使用多重签名钱包时,用户需要衡量自己的需求和技术能力。
5. 我可以在多重签名钱包中使用哪些类型的币?
多重签名钱包主要是为比特币设计的,但随着加密货币市场的发展,许多主流加密货币钱包也开始支持多重签名功能,不限于比特币。
- 以太坊(Ethereum):以太坊支持的多重签名协议,例如 Gnosis Safe,可以实现以太坊和 ERC20 代币的多重签名管理。
- 比特币现金(Bitcoin Cash):很多比特币现金钱包也集成了多重签名钱包的功能。
- 其他加密货币:许多持有多种加密货币的用户,也在寻找能支持多重签名的跨链钱包。
不过,用户在选择支持多重签名的加密货币钱包时,应确保其所用的币种也得到了好的支持和文档,以便于操作与管理。
总结而言,比特币多重签名钱包为用户提供了一种更加安全和便利的资金管理方式。通过弹性的签名要求和多方控制,用户可以更放心地进行比特币的存储与交易。在阅读本文后,用户应当能更好地理解多重签名钱包的工作原理、设置方式及其优缺点,从而在自己的数字资产管理中做出明智的选择。